Which atmospheric layer is rich in ozone?
Which atmospheric layer is rich in ozone? Stratosphere Why is ozone above oxygen? Up in the higher reaches of the atmosphere, ozone is constantly being created due to all that sunlight constantly slamming into oxygen molecules and breaking them apart. That’s why the ozone concentration is higher up there than it is back on Earth. […]
Which instrument is used to measure the depth of sea?
Which instrument is used to measure the depth of sea? Depth finder, also called echo sounder, device used on ships to determine the depth of water by measuring the time it takes a sound (sonic pulse) produced just below the water surface to return, or echo, from the bottom of the body of water.
